Aragorn hurried toward Bree, but at the edge of a pasture, he paused. A mist hovered over daisies blooming thick upon it, and his imagination was caught by a capricious intersect of sun, fog and flower. How like the ephemeral mists of niphredil blooming on Cerin Amroth was that lowly Bree-land field! His mind chased after his heart and he saw then his hand tucking a fair blossom of Lúthien in the hair of his beloved Evenstar, on a midsummer evening so long ago.
He breathed in a long, slow breath, and in his sigh dwelt loneliness and hope intermingled.
